To that end, faecal samples before and after a red wine intervention study … Web17 nov. 2024 · What does it mean if hematocrit is low? A low hematocrit number means that your body doesn't have enough red blood cells in your blood. This is also called anemia. What hematocrit level is considered anemic? Web15 dec. 2024 · Low hematocrit, or anemia, can be caused by blood loss, the body making fewer red blood cells, or increased destruction of red blood cells. Symptoms of anemia can include difficulty breathing, dizziness, headache, cold skin, pale skin, and chest pain [ 72 ].

WebAnemia has broad implications. First, the low hemoglobin and hematocrit are associated with poor quality of life and performance and affect daily activity. Second, anemia has an impact on the cardiovascular system.
